Punches, dies and production tooling should be assessed against their steel grade, geometry and required properties before treatment begins. No single furnace cycle or hardness target suits every tool-steel component.
What Must Be Confirmed Before Tool Steel Heat Treatment?
Tool steel heat treatment changes material properties through controlled heating, cooling and tempering. The appropriate route depends on the specified grade, starting condition, section size, target hardness, intended application and acceptable dimensional risk.
Manufacturers should provide:
- Material grade: Identify the complete tool-steel designation and supply supporting material information where available.
- Starting condition: State whether the component is annealed, pre-hardened or has undergone earlier thermal processing.
- Component dimensions: Provide actual dimensions, section thicknesses and unit weight.
- Target hardness: Nominate the required hardness range and testing location rather than requesting the highest achievable value.
- Critical tolerances: Mark dimensions, datums and surfaces where movement could affect assembly or finishing.
- Finishing allowance: Identify stock reserved for grinding or another operation after treatment.
- Quantity: Confirm the number of components and whether they belong to one material batch.
- Governing specification: Supply the approved drawing, customer standard or processing instruction.

Different Tooling May Require Different Processes
Punches, dies, shear blades and mould tooling require different hardness, toughness and dimensional properties. Geometry, including thin edges, holes and uneven sections, can affect how a component responds to heating and quenching. Specify the tool’s function and critical areas, while considering the steel supplier’s guidance and applicable engineering specifications.

Hardness Is Only One Processing Requirement
A hardness value does not describe the complete performance requirement for industrial tooling. Toughness, wear behaviour, surface condition, microstructure and dimensional change may also matter. Pursuing excessive hardness without considering these factors can produce the wrong balance for the application.
The ASM International guide to heat treating tool steels identifies subjects including steel selection, hardening, quenching, tempering, dimensional change and failure analysis. These variables reinforce why the treatment specification must be connected to the actual material and tool design.
Our published technical data also explains that achievable hardness depends on the metal’s chemical analysis. Published values are general technical information, not a guaranteed outcome for every component. The agreed specification and assessment remain the basis for processing.
